Underprivileged schools win ‘World’s Best School’ prize

Underprivileged schools in Uganda, Chile, the Philippines, and Scotland have won in the World’s Best Schools competition. The contest is run by T4 Education digital platform, which also awarded the schools with large cash prizes. The World’s host Marco Werman spoke with Vikas Pota, founder of T4 Education, about the need to fund schools and education around the world.
